Certified Python Developer
Description
Certified Python Developer
The Certified Python Developer course is a professionally designed exam-based certification program intended for individuals aiming to validate their Python programming skills in real-world scenarios. Whether you are preparing for a technical certification, job interview, or simply looking to assess your proficiency in Python, this course provides a rigorous and structured evaluation of your capabilities.
This course consists of six comprehensive exams, each containing a curated set of questions that span a broad spectrum of Python topics. The content includes but is not limited to: Python syntax and semantics, data structures, control flow, functions, object-oriented programming, file handling, error management, standard libraries, and commonly used third-party modules. The exams are crafted to reflect practical coding problems as well as theoretical concepts, challenging your ability to apply knowledge effectively.
Every question is paired with a clear and concise explanation of the correct answer. These explanations serve to reinforce learning, clarify misunderstandings, and offer insights into best practices and Pythonic design principles.
To earn the Certified Python Developer certificate, learners must successfully pass all six exams. This ensures that certified individuals demonstrate not only a solid foundation but also an applied understanding of Python programming. Begin your path toward Python certification with confidence and professionalism.
Certificate of Completion
If you would like to receive a certificate of completion, please report directly to instructor after successfully passing all exams. This certificate serves as a recognition of your achievement and mastery of the course material.
Python: Code Less, Create More
Python is a powerful, high-level programming language known for its simplicity, readability, and versatility. It supports multiple programming paradigms and is widely used in web development, data science, machine learning, automation, and software engineering. With an extensive standard library and a vibrant ecosystem of third-party packages, Python empowers developers to build robust applications quickly and efficiently.
Can I retake the exams?
Yes, you're welcome to retake each exam as many times as you'd like. After completing an exam, you'll receive your final score. Each time you retake the exam, the questions and answer choices will be shuffled for a new experience.
Is there a time limit for the exams?
Yes, each exam has a time limit.
What score do I need to pass?
To pass each exam, you need to score at least 70%.
Are explanations provided for the questions?
Yes, detailed explanations are provided for every question to help you understand the material better.
Can I review my answers after the test?
Absolutely! You can review all your answers, including which ones were correct or incorrect.
Are the questions updated frequently?
Yes, the questions are regularly updated to ensure you're getting the most relevant and current information.
Who this course is for:
- Python Developers
- Software Engineers and Developers
- Data Analysts and Data Scientists
- Automation and DevOps Engineers
- Test Automation Engineers
- Freelancers and Consultants
- Career Changers and Technology Enthusiasts
Instructor
EN
Python Developer/AI Enthusiast/Data Scientist/Stockbroker
Enthusiast of new technologies, particularly in the areas of artificial intelligence, the Python language, big data and cloud solutions. Graduate of postgraduate studies at the Polish-Japanese Academy of Information Technology in the field of Computer Science and Big Data specialization. Master's degree graduate in Financial and Actuarial Mathematics at the Faculty of Mathematics and Computer Science at the University of Lodz. Former PhD student at the faculty of mathematics. Since 2015, a licensed Securities Broker with the right to provide investment advisory services (license number 3073). Lecturer at the GPW Foundation, conducting training for investors in the field of technical analysis, behavioral finance, and principles of managing a portfolio of financial instruments.
Founder at e-smartdata
PL
Python Developer/AI Enthusiast/Data Scientist/Stockbroker
Jestem miłośnikiem nowych technologii, szczególnie w obszarze sztucznej inteligencji, języka Python big data oraz rozwiązań chmurowych. Posiadam stopień absolwenta podyplomowych studiów na kierunku Informatyka, specjalizacja Big Data w Polsko-Japońskiej Akademii Technik Komputerowych oraz magistra z Matematyki Finansowej i Aktuarialnej na wydziale Matematyki i Informatyki Uniwersytetu Łódzkiego. Od 2015 roku posiadam licencję Maklera Papierów Wartościowych z uprawnieniami do czynności doradztwa inwestycyjnego (nr 3073). Jestem również wykładowcą w Fundacji GPW prowadzącym szkolenia dla inwestorów z zakresu analizy technicznej, finansów behawioralnych i zasad zarządzania portfelem instrumentów finansowych. Mam doświadczenie w prowadzeniu zajęć dydaktycznych na wyższej uczelni z przedmiotów związanych z rachunkiem prawdopodobieństwa i statystyką. Moje główne obszary zainteresowań to język Python, sztuczna inteligencja, web development oraz rynki finansowe.
Założyciel platformy e-smartdata